Type
ORACLE
Validation date
2024-10-03 07:07: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01152,
    "usd": 0.01272
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011ECCEC9501DEB50210166464CADC04E62E03E0BB5F89DB4417601DF0EC6AED4A

Previous signature

2F5249A71A0224BE7B7085D5D13CC319657B03CEDA1696C64CACD3408570D68E6856CE0483CD833D66C1098605AED4CC16BC941ABEE29AAD44FAF733B8F1AD03

Origin signature

304402206653F962E523296FDD37465DC345C182C11B39F64860797A2ACA831F55A64AFB02206772664219435D540E61F87845F1BD8B010C756E128646EC087DE70F1A4932AE

Proof of work

01010484B78F4110D8E9D6FBEC72759895CC9D4532177314FBAA8B07BC525FC1AF48F150EFBF104B1819106B8E3563CD0E1FAAE5325F8FCFE58FF744C35F47669D2704

Proof of integrity

00092EFAA77119227C9B7A976DC5093C13BD604C8FE676CC46314A9F58FD59B32A

Coordinator signature

4A287E2652FA0F17D27054E3EF3EC7F96BE719670C8226AE45153CE7B2924223A237B35D7C7A78E20C24CA36600A64E1D7FBC7C992B9E09FABA1BDCDD17AC107

Validator #1 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#1 signature

80D59B14703A26618566FAF52A5576C638D56B6BC510239976530CAC2DC7B75D07F43DD72A880AB1074366CF6C0B8FFD643FCD751BFFBADD2D0AE1F609DD100A

Validator #2 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#2 signature

A4729CB2912B894874B2BA2B678BB612CA6BBEAD9CCC715AE5C500CDC81CE6487D00FA40CE41F4BBE509381705F8C16D3C3D30E4A710790F2831DD72AE82C501